Article Overview
This article summarizes Medicare’s July 1 durable medical equipment policy changes affecting selected hand, finger, and spinal orthoses. It is useful for DME suppliers, orthotists, coders, and compliance staff who need to understand the scope of the coverage updates, the role of PDAC classification verification, and the general types of claims affected under the new policy framework.
Why This Topic Matters
These updates can change whether orthotic claims are payable, noncovered, or subject to additional verification steps. The article helps billing and compliance teams understand which categories of orthoses are being reassessed and why claim processing may change.
